Realistically, both games were over had I known you didn't play Force, G1 the play I made beat Force but lost to a 2nd Vendillion or a Karakas and you had the 2 outer, and G2 you drew out of a mull to 5 before I did despite being a 12-4 favorite in cantrip counts. I also got greedy G1 and ran my Thoughtseize into a Daze based on having extra cantrips, which may or may not have made a difference or been wrong.
Based on my experience with previous Bant decks, you are probably around a 30-70 dog in the match up.

It seems to me, most people either over-estimate or under-estimate their Storm match ups. That is usually directed to their first match up against Storm with the deck too.
That being said, I definitely think this Bant list is insanely good, and if it gets popular, TES and ANT will come back in a big way.
Good TES and ANT lists with a decent pilot should have no issues taking a crap on these FoW-less decks. MMS + Daze is not enough to hold off the Storm.
Once storm comes back, Countertop decks will start to re-emerge from the depths. Perhaps people are tired of Countertop and wanted to play other control decks (hence the lack of countertop decks).
